Abstract

877,116. Tube walls for furnaces. BABCOCK & WILCOX Ltd. April 29, 1960 [May 1, 1959], No. 15044/59. Class 51 (1). Horizontal tubes lining the walls of a boiler furnace are connected in parallel and arranged so that each of the parallel circuits receives approximately the same heat input and are supported by vertical members which are heated during operation to reduce differential vertical expansion. Wall tubes 23 connected in pairs to rods 25, Figs. 4, 5 are supported from slots 21 in vertical members 20 within the furnace insulation 47. The members 20 are supported by lugs 30 from vertical stays 28, which are supported from horizontal back-stays 43 so as to allow for differential horizontal expansion. The furnace wall is sealed by plates 39, strips 41, 42 sealing the horizontal gaps between plates 39 and the gaps between the plates 39 and supports 20 respectively, while allowing expansion. The support members 20 may be replaced by angle members 52, 53 welded to vertical tubes 51 connected in the boiler circulation, Figs. 7, 8. The furnace wall is divided into zones, each zone receiving a different heat input, and the tubes of each zone are divided into groups. The tube groups comprise pairs of tubes, each tube pair having adjacent inlet and outlet ends, and the tubes of a pair extending in opposite directions round the furnace walls. The adjacent inlet ends of pair of tubes are connected to tubes 68 leading from a lower zone and adjacent outlet ends of another pair of tubes of the same group are connected to tubes 67 leading to corresponding tubes in an upper zone by bores 70 in a block 69, Figs. 11 and 13, and the tubes 67 form part of the suspension of the tube walls, Fig. 12. The tubes of a group may be crashed sidewardly near their inlet and outlet ends, so that a plate 81, Fig. 16, may be welded between the tubes 84 leading to the upper zones and the tubes 83 leading to the lower zones so that the upright tubes may support the horizontal wall tubes. The furnace may have a lower part lined with vertical tube lengths, and horizontal tube lengths lining the upper region of the furnace may be connected in series by upright tube lengths lining the side walls of a lateral gas pass. The firing zone or the region of the burner ports in the firing zone may be lined with upright tubes.
